Cascata del Lavane is a stunning waterfall nestled in the province of Forlì-Cesena, Italy, offering a serene escape into nature. Surrounded by lush woodlands, it's a haven for relaxation, photography, and light hiking.

Car
If driving, head towards Portico e San Benedetto. From there, follow local signs for 'Cascata del Lavane'. A small parking area is available near the falls. Be aware that some roads may have tolls. Parking is free.
Public Transport
To reach Cascata del Lavane via public transport, take a train from Florence to Borgo San Lorenzo. Then, catch a local bus towards Portico e San Benedetto. From the village, it's approximately a 1.5-kilometer walk to the waterfall. Check bus schedules in advance as services may be limited. A bus ticket will likely cost around €2-€5.
Walking
From Portico e San Benedetto, follow the signs towards Cascata del Lavane. The walk is approximately 1.5 kilometers and should take around 20-30 minutes. Ask locals for directions if needed.
